Where A Robot Vacuum That Maps Your House Helps Most
A robot vacuum that maps your house saves you the most effort in a multi-room home, where it finishes one room while another door stays shut, then moves on in order. If your home has stairs, a robot vacuum with multi-floor mapping keeps a separate plan for each level, so carrying it upstairs never means mapping from scratch again.
Homes with pets get real use out of saved zones. You can flag the area around food bowls for an extra pass, or fence off a delicate rug so the robot vacuum steers clear. And when only the kitchen needs attention after dinner, you send it to that one room instead of running the whole floor.
How To Choose A Robot Vacuum With Mapping
-
Start with how it navigates
Navigation matters even more if your floor plan is complex. LiDAR spins a laser to measure walls and furniture for a precise map, while AI cameras add object recognition so the robot vacuum works around clutter instead of pushing it.
For the sharpest mapping in low light and under furniture, a flagship like the Dreame X60 Max Ultra Complete combines both. Mostly open floors do fine on camera-and-laser navigation from a mid-collection model.

Covering more than one floor
If your home has multiple floors, pick a robot vacuum that stores a separate plan for each level, so you're not remapping every time you move it up or down. Check that the model saves multiple maps before you buy, since not every mapping model does.

Steering it from your phone
App-based room selection and no-go zones let you send the robot vacuum to the kitchen alone or fence off a rug or a water bowl. If you like starting and skipping rooms yourself, prioritize a model with saved zones and virtual walls, like the Dreame L60 Pro Ultra.

Fitting your home size and budget
Larger homes do best with a bigger battery and a self-emptying dock, so you're not constantly dealing with it between runs, while a smaller apartment pairs well with an affordable robot vacuum that maps and nails the basics.
